Many SMS campaigns fail before they even start, simply because the phone numbers are invalid or inactive. The result? Wasted marketing spend, low engagement rates, and frustrated teams chasing meaningless metrics. Ignoring number validation undermines campaign effectiveness and ROI.
That’s where HLR lookup comes in. By leveraging this technology, businesses can verify numbers instantly, target the right audience, and turn every SMS into a measurable, profitable interaction. In this article, we’ll explore how HLR lookup boosts SMS marketing ROI, helping you maximize returns, reduce churn, and optimize overall campaign performance.
What is HLR Lookup?
HLR Lookup, or Home Location Register Lookup, is a real-time process used to check the current status and validity of a mobile phone number. It retrieves information directly from a mobile network’s Home Location Register — a central database that stores details about every mobile subscriber, including their current network, roaming status, and whether the number is active or inactive.
This lookup helps businesses, especially in telecom and SMS marketing, identify whether a number can receive messages before sending them. By doing so, it reduces message delivery failures, saves costs, and ensures that communication reaches genuine and reachable users.
In simpler terms, HLR Lookup acts as a mobile number verification tool, allowing marketers and service providers to validate contact lists with high accuracy. This makes it an essential component of efficient and cost-effective SMS marketing campaigns.
How HLR Lookup Works
HLR Lookup operates by connecting to a mobile network’s Home Location Register (HLR) — a central database that holds essential details about every mobile subscriber. When a lookup request is made, the system queries the HLR in real time to fetch information about the number’s status, network, and roaming activity.
This helps identify whether a phone number is active, inactive, switched off, or ported to another carrier. The lookup response also includes the Mobile Country Code (MCC) and Mobile Network Code (MNC), helping businesses understand the user’s location and operator details.
By checking these details before launching an SMS campaign, marketers can filter out invalid or unreachable numbers. This ensures higher message deliverability, lower bounce rates, and better overall SMS marketing ROI.
Step-by-Step: How HLR Lookup Works

Request Initiation: A lookup request is sent for each mobile number.
HLR Query: The system connects to the mobile operator’s HLR database.
Data Retrieval: The HLR returns real-time information such as network, status, and roaming info.
Result Filtering: Invalid or unreachable numbers are removed from the campaign list.
Campaign Execution: SMS messages are sent only to verified, active users.
Why HLR Lookup is Essential for Your Business
In SMS marketing, accuracy is everything. Sending messages to inactive or invalid numbers wastes both time and money. HLR Lookup ensures your contact lists are clean and up to date, so your campaigns only target real, reachable users.
This verification process not only improves SMS delivery rates but also strengthens your overall campaign performance. By identifying ported or roaming numbers, businesses can personalize communication based on the user’s current network or location.
Moreover, using HLR Lookup reduces SMS gateway costs, prevents fraudulent or fake registrations, and increases the return on marketing investment. It’s a simple yet powerful tool that enhances both operational efficiency and customer engagement.
For businesses that rely on SMS for notifications, promotions, or verifications, HLR Lookup is not just an add-on, it’s a must-have for maintaining high deliverability and trust in customer communication.
Key Benefits of HLR Lookup in SMS Marketing
Using HLR lookup gives marketers a strong advantage by improving campaign efficiency, accuracy, and ROI. Here are the key benefits it brings to your SMS marketing strategy:
Improved Message Deliverability
HLR lookup verifies every number before sending an SMS, ensuring messages reach active and valid users only. This helps reduce delivery failures and bounce rates.
Reduced Marketing Costs
By removing invalid or inactive contacts, you avoid wasting money on undelivered messages. This leads to optimized campaign spending and a higher return on investment.
Better Targeting and Personalization
HLR data reveals real-time network and location information, allowing marketers to personalize offers based on carrier or region. This boosts engagement and response rates.
Fraud Prevention
HLR lookup helps identify fake or temporary numbers often used in spam or fraudulent registrations. This keeps your customer database clean and secure.
Accurate Analytics and Reporting
With verified and up-to-date contact data, your SMS performance metrics — such as delivery rate, conversion rate, and ROI become more accurate and actionable.
Enhanced Global Reach
For international campaigns, HLR lookup ensures compliance with carrier requirements and confirms network validity, helping you reach global audiences more reliably.
HLR Lookup vs Other Number Verification Methods
Not all number verification methods offer the same level of accuracy and insight. While many marketers rely on basic validation tools to clean their contact lists, HLR Lookup stands out for its real-time data and network-level verification. Let’s explore how it differs from other approaches.
| Feature / Method | HLR Lookup | Database Validation | Ping or Test SMS | Manual Verification | Generic API Check |
| Accuracy | Very high (real-time network data) | Medium (static database) | High, but limited | Low, human error possible | Medium (depends on source) |
| Real-Time Status Check | Yes | No | Yes, but sends message | No | Sometimes |
| Cost Efficiency | High (no message sent) | High | Low (SMS cost applies) | Very low | Moderate |
| Privacy & Compliance | Fully compliant (silent query) | Compliant | May violate anti-spam laws | Depends on process | Depends on provider |
| Network Information (MCC/MNC) | Provided | Not available | Not available | Not available | Limited |
| Scalability | Excellent | Good | Limited | Poor | Good |
| Use Case Suitability | Best for large-scale SMS campaigns | Basic list cleaning | Testing small lists | Small, manual checks | Quick but less precise validation |
Summary: Among all methods, HLR Lookup provides the most accurate, real-time, and scalable number verification solution. It ensures you send SMS messages only to active users, improving delivery rates, reducing costs, and maximizing ROI — making it the go-to choice for serious SMS marketers.
Use Cases of HLR Lookup in Different Industries
HLR Lookup is a powerful tool that supports a wide range of industries where mobile communication and customer verification are critical. From telecom to e-commerce, it helps businesses improve accuracy, reduce costs, and boost engagement.
Telecom Operators and SMS Aggregators
Telecom carriers and SMS service providers use HLR lookup to validate subscriber databases and eliminate inactive numbers before launching bulk SMS campaigns. This ensures higher delivery rates, optimized routing, and cost savings across millions of messages.
Banking and Financial Services
Banks and fintech companies rely on HLR lookup for secure customer verification during OTP delivery, account activation, and transaction alerts. By verifying the number’s status in real time, they can prevent fraudulent sign-ups and ensure critical messages reach the right user instantly.
E-commerce and Retail
E-commerce brands use HLR lookup to verify customer numbers during registration or checkout. This helps maintain clean CRM data, reduce failed delivery notifications, and improve the success rate of order updates, promotions, and re-engagement campaigns.
Travel and Hospitality
Travel agencies and airlines use HLR lookup to send real-time booking confirmations, flight updates, or travel alerts only to active users. This ensures reliable communication with travelers while avoiding costs from invalid or inactive numbers.
Enterprise Communication Platforms
Enterprises with large customer databases use HLR lookup to maintain accurate and updated contact lists across their communication systems. This supports multi-channel messaging, improves data quality, and strengthens customer engagement strategies.
How to Integrate HLR Lookup into Your SMS Platform
Integrating HLR Lookup into your SMS platform ensures that your campaigns reach active, valid numbers while reducing costs and improving ROI. Follow these steps for a smooth implementation:
Choose a Reliable HLR Lookup Provider
Select a provider that offers real-time number verification, global coverage, and secure API access. Check for features like carrier identification, roaming status, and compliance with data privacy regulations.
Obtain API Credentials
Once registered, you will receive API keys or credentials to connect your SMS platform with the HLR service. Keep these credentials secure to ensure authorized and safe usage.
Integrate API with Your Platform
Use the provider’s API documentation to integrate HLR Lookup into your SMS sending workflow. Most APIs support HTTP requests or SDKs for popular programming languages.
Set Up Pre-Send Number Validation
Before sending any SMS, run your contact list through the HLR lookup API. This will filter out inactive, ported, or invalid numbers, ensuring only reachable users receive your messages.
Automate Reporting and Analytics
Configure your platform to record lookup results, delivery success, and number status. This helps monitor campaign efficiency and maintain an updated, clean subscriber database.
Test and Optimize
Start with a small batch of numbers to ensure API integration works correctly. Monitor results, identify errors, and optimize the workflow for scalability and accuracy.
Pro Tip: Automating HLR lookups as part of your SMS sending pipeline ensures consistent data quality and maximizes campaign ROI while minimizing wasted messages.
How HLR Lookup Delivers Better ROI for SMS Campaigns
Investing in HLR lookup services might seem like an extra expense, but the benefits far outweigh the cost. By verifying mobile numbers in real time, you ensure your messages reach active, engaged users, improving campaign performance and maximizing ROI.
Key Benefits:
- Cut Wasted SMS Spend: Avoid sending messages to inactive or invalid numbers, saving money with every campaign.
- Boost Engagement Rates: Reach only real, active users, leading to higher response and conversion rates.
- Enhance Campaign Metrics: Improved delivery translates to better open rates, click-through rates, and measurable ROI.
- Prevent Fraud & Errors: Sensitive notifications, OTPs, or promotions don’t reach the wrong recipients, keeping your brand safe.
Example ROI Calculation with HLR Lookup:
| Metric | Without HLR Lookup | With HLR Lookup | Impact / Value Added |
| Total SMS Sent | 100,000 | 88,000 | 12% reduction in wasted sends |
| Cost per SMS ($) | 0.10 | 0.10 | — |
| Total Cost ($) | 10,000 | 8,800 | $1,200 savings |
| SMS Delivered (%) | 88% | 97% | 9% improvement in delivery rate |
| Messages Reaching Users | 88,000 | 85,360 | 3,360 more real users reached despite fewer messages |
| Engagement Rate (%) | 15% | 18% | Higher conversions due to valid numbers |
| Conversions | 13,200 | 15,365 | 16% increase in conversions |
| ROI on Campaign Spend | 1.5x | 2x | Maximized ROI per dollar spent |
| Fraud / Invalid Messages | High | Minimal | Protects sensitive info and reduces risks |
Even though fewer SMS are sent, the delivery, engagement, and conversions improve significantly. HLR lookup ensures your marketing spend is directed toward real, reachable users, reducing waste and maximizing ROI. Businesses can now measure success not just by the number of SMS sent, but by actual customer impact.
Future Trends: HLR Lookup and SMS Marketing
As SMS marketing continues to evolve, HLR lookup is becoming increasingly critical for businesses seeking efficiency and higher ROI. With the rise of mobile number portability, global roaming, and multi-network users, real-time number verification ensures messages reach the right audience.
AI-Powered HLR Insights
The next wave of HLR lookup services integrates AI and machine learning to predict number activity, optimize sending times, and even segment users for better targeting.
Global Reach and Multi-Network Support
With international SMS campaigns growing, HLR lookup will expand to provide accurate verification across countries, networks, and carriers, reducing undelivered messages globally.
Integration with Omnichannel Marketing
Future HLR solutions will seamlessly integrate with email, push notifications, and chat platforms, helping businesses unify their communication strategies and improve engagement.
Enhanced Fraud Prevention
As mobile fraud evolves, HLR lookup will increasingly be used to validate users in real time, preventing fake registrations, spam, and unauthorized access.
Conclusion: Maximizing ROI with HLR Lookup
HLR lookup is a must-have for businesses relying on SMS marketing. By verifying numbers in real time, it reduces wasted spend, ensures messages reach active users, and boosts campaign ROI.
Beyond cost savings, it improves engagement, conversions, and customer trust while protecting sensitive information. Automated workflows and analytics make campaigns more efficient and measurable.
Looking ahead, AI insights, global coverage, and omnichannel integration will make HLR lookup even more strategic, helping businesses reach the right audience smarter and faster.